Why Estimating Needs to Be Standardized to Scale

When estimating is handled differently across teams, it creates friction. You might not notice it at first, but over time, the impact adds up. Small inconsistencies in cost assumptions, formatting, or scope interpretation can lead to major issues—especially when you’re bidding on complex projects or managing multiple regions.

Here’s what tends to happen when estimating isn’t standardized:

  • Inconsistent cost assumptions: One team uses outdated unit prices, another uses inflated labor rates.
  • Formatting chaos: Every estimator has their own spreadsheet layout, making it hard to compare or audit.
  • Communication breakdowns: Project managers and procurement teams struggle to interpret estimates built with different logic.
  • Delayed bids: Teams spend extra time reconciling formats and assumptions before submitting.
  • Margin erosion: Errors and omissions creep in, leading to change orders and cost overruns.

Let’s look at a typical example situation:

A mid-size contractor has three regional offices. Each office uses its own estimating spreadsheet, built years ago by different team members. One office includes overhead in line items, another adds it at the end, and the third forgets it entirely. When the company tries to consolidate bids or compare performance across regions, the numbers don’t line up. Leadership spends hours trying to reconcile estimates, and projects end up mispriced. Over time, this leads to lost bids and shrinking margins.

Core Components of a Scalable Estimating Workflow

To build an estimating process that works across teams and projects, you need more than just good habits—you need the right components. These are the building blocks that allow your workflow to grow without breaking down.

Centralized Cost Libraries

A centralized cost library is the foundation. It’s where your unit prices, labor rates, material costs, and productivity factors live. When everyone pulls from the same source, you eliminate guesswork and reduce errors.

  • You avoid duplicate entries and outdated pricing
  • Estimators spend less time hunting for data
  • You can update costs globally instead of one file at a time

Estimating Platforms

Modern estimating platforms help you move faster and reduce manual work. They’re built to handle complex scopes, link to cost libraries, and support multiple users. You don’t need to rely on spreadsheets that crash or formulas that break.

  • Built-in templates and logic reduce setup time
  • Real-time collaboration allows multiple estimators to work together
  • Audit trails help you track changes and maintain transparency

API Integrations

Estimating doesn’t live in a vacuum. It connects to procurement, scheduling, finance, and project management. API integrations allow your estimating platform to talk to other systems—so you’re not copying and pasting data between tools.

  • Procurement teams can see estimated quantities and costs instantly
  • Schedulers can build timelines based on actual scope
  • Finance can forecast cash flow based on real bids

Example situation:

A general contractor uses an estimating platform that connects to their procurement system. When the estimator finalizes quantities, the procurement team sees them immediately and starts sourcing materials. This cuts the bid-to-buy cycle by nearly half and reduces the risk of ordering errors.

How to Design a Workflow That Works Across Teams and Projects

Once you have the right components, you need to design a workflow that’s usable by every team—whether they’re estimating a small job or a multi-phase development.

Role-Based Access and Permissions

Not everyone needs access to everything. Estimators should be able to build and edit, while project managers might only need to view. Role-based access helps you control who can do what, without slowing anyone down.

  • Estimators: full access to build and modify
  • Project managers: view-only access to approved estimates
  • Finance: access to cost breakdowns and summaries

Templates and Repeatable Processes

Templates save time and reduce errors. You can create standard formats for different project types—commercial, residential, infrastructure—and reuse them across bids.

  • Less time spent formatting and structuring
  • Easier onboarding for new estimators
  • Consistent outputs for downstream teams

Version Control and Audit Trails

Estimates change. You need to know who changed what, when, and why. Version control lets you track revisions, compare versions, and roll back if needed.

  • Prevents accidental overwrites
  • Supports internal reviews and approvals
  • Builds trust with clients and stakeholders

What’s Next for Estimating Workflows

Estimating is evolving. The tools and processes you use today should be ready for what’s coming tomorrow. That means building a system that can adapt and grow.

AI-Assisted Estimating

AI tools can help you analyze historical data, flag anomalies, and suggest cost ranges. They don’t replace estimators—they help them work faster and smarter.

  • Identify missing scope items based on past projects
  • Suggest productivity rates based on similar jobs
  • Flag outliers in unit costs or quantities

Predictive Cost Modeling

By analyzing past projects, you can build models that predict costs more accurately. These models help you bid with confidence—even on unfamiliar scopes.

  • Use historical data to forecast costs
  • Adjust for location, seasonality, and market trends
  • Improve win rates with tighter margins

Cloud-Based Collaboration

Remote teams, joint ventures, and multi-office setups need real-time access. Cloud-based platforms allow everyone to work from the same estimate—no emailing files or waiting for updates.

  • Real-time updates across locations
  • Easier coordination with external partners
  • Reduced version conflicts and delays

Common Pitfalls and How to Avoid Them

Even with the best tools, estimating workflows can go off track. Here are some common issues and how to avoid them.

  • Over-customization: Too many tweaks to templates or libraries can lead to confusion. Keep things simple and consistent.
  • Lack of stakeholder buy-in: If project managers or finance teams aren’t involved, estimates won’t reflect real needs. Include them early.
  • Ignoring integration: Siloed systems mean double entry and missed data. Choose platforms that connect to your existing tools.

How to Get Started: A Practical Roadmap

You don’t need to rebuild everything at once. Start with a few key steps and build from there.

  • Audit your current estimating process: Identify what’s working and what’s slowing you down.
  • Find gaps and inefficiencies: Look for manual steps, inconsistent data, and delays.
  • Choose the right platform: Pick a tool that supports centralized libraries, templates, and integrations.
  • Train your teams: Make sure everyone knows how to use the new system. Collect feedback and improve as you go.
